Jaat Box Office Day 3: Sunny Deol's film "Jaat" has astonished the industry with its phenomenal performance on its third day at the box office. Released on Thursday, the film earned ₹9.62 crore on its first day and ₹7 crore on the second. Although a slight dip was recorded on Friday due to it being a working day, the film showed a spectacular resurgence on Saturday, its third day. According to initial figures, by 3:25 PM, the film had already earned ₹2.72 crore, and it is estimated to reach ₹8-9 crore by the end of the day, including evening and night shows. Thus, the film's total collection so far is approximately ₹19.34 crore.
Baisakhi and Ambedkar Jayanti Act as Box Office Boosters
The film is benefiting immensely from the long weekend. The Baisakhi weekend, starting on Saturday, and the Ambedkar Jayanti holiday on Monday are contributing to excellent footfalls in both multiplexes and single-screen theaters. Trade analysts believe the film could cross ₹35 crore in the next two days, surpassing Sunny Deol's recent hit "Ghayal Once Again" (₹35.7 crore).
10-Year Record Broken; Only "Gadar 2" and "Ghayal Once Again" Ahead in the Race
"Jaat" has surpassed approximately 10 of Sunny Deol's films from the past decade within its first three days. These include films like "I Love NY" (₹1.54 crore), "Poster Boys" (₹12.73 crore), and "Chup" (₹9.75 crore). Only "Gadar 2" (₹525.45 crore) and "Ghayal Once Again" are currently ahead. If this momentum continues, "Jaat" could compete with these two films in the coming week.
South Director and Strong Star Cast Give "Jaat" an Edge
The film is directed by successful South Indian director Gopichand Malineni, whose vision and experience with action are clearly visible in "Jaat." Producer Mythri Movie Makers, associated with mega-projects like "Pushpa 2," gave the film a grand look. Made on a budget of ₹100 crore, the film stars Sunny Deol alongside a b cast including Regina Cassandra, Randeep Hooda, Vineet Kumar Singh, Ramya Krishnan, and Jagapathi Babu, who have given the film a pan-India appeal.
